Azerbaijan University launched a differentiated compensation system for academic staff

Starting from the 2025/2026 academic year, Azerbaijan University has initiated the implementation of a differentiated compensation system aimed at stimulating the scientific and pedagogical activities of its academic staff. In connection with this, the Science Department and the Quality Assurance Department jointly organized an information session for faculty members.

Opening the event, Vice-Rector for Scientific Affairs, Dr. of Mathematical Sciences Yusif Gasimov noted that the decision was adopted at a meeting of the Academic Council. He emphasized that under the new system, salary bonuses will be differentiated based on a ranking list formed according to individual indicators of the academic staff’s research performance. The primary objective is to enhance the quality and productivity of scientific activity, strengthen the competitive environment among faculty members, and increase their professionalism and motivation.

Yusif Gasimov highlighted that the stimulation of research activities at Azerbaijan University has been ongoing since 2018. University Rector Saadat Aliyeva has issued several directives aimed at improving the organization of research activities and encouraging staff engagement in scientific work. The introduction of the differentiated compensation system marks a new stage in these efforts.

This was followed by a presentation by the Head of the Science Department, PhD in Mathematics Latifa Agamaliyeva, titled “Criteria for assessing scientific activity”, while the Head of the Quality Assurance Department, Lala Abasova, delivered a presentation on “Criteria for assessing teaching performance”. They noted that the differentiation of salaries will be carried out across several components, including research indicators, monitoring of teaching activities, and participation in professional development modules organized by the University’s Training and Teaching Centre.

The infosession continued with an open discussion following the presentations.

In conclusion, Vice-Rector Yusif Gasimov, Head of the Science Department Latifa Agamaliyeva, and Head of the Quality Assurance Department Lala Abasova answered questions from the academic staff and listened to their suggestions.
